      II.2.4) Description of the procurement: Procurement Assist Limited invited to tender organisations wishing to participate in a 48 month national Framework Agreement for the Supply of Materials and Associated Services. The Framework Agreement was to operate as a supplies agreement, across the United Kingdom, including Wales, Scotland, England and Northern Ireland. The Framework Agreement would have been accessible by all current and future Clients of Procurement Assist Limited. The Framework Agreement may have been used by all NHS Trusts, Social Housing Providers, Local Authorities, Blue Light Services, Education establishments and Charities, and all other contracting authorities that are located in the United Kingdom including those listed in Schedule 1 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015/102. The scope of the Framework Agreement was to supply materials to the public sector, through various delivery service models and provide associated services to maintain a sustainable supply chain. The procurement process was undertaken, and upon evaluation of submissions, on 8 August 2023 it was identified that separate evaluation criteria should have been applied across the Lots rather than one criteria applied across all Lots. After careful consideration Procurement Assist Limited made the decision to abandon the procurement process under Regulation 55 (1) (a) of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 (PCR2015) for the Supply of Materials and Associated Services Framework Agreement for which there has been a call for competition. All bidders were notified of this decision and this procurement process is now closed. Procurement Assist will assess the evaluation criterion methodology and seek to re-tender the framework agreement at a later date.
